FRISCO, Texas — The emotion of the day weighed intensely upon the heart of the Dallas Cowboys as a collective, and DeMarvion Overshown as a close friend of Marshawn Kneeland, working to balance grief over the loss of someone he considered his brother with the excitement of returning to the field for the first time since tearing his ACL last December.
Initially thought to be on a pitch count in his return to action, Overshown instead racked up 31 total snaps in the Cowboys' plundering of the Las Vegas Raiders on Monday Night Football, more than half of the defensive reps tallied at Allegiant Stadium — carrying Kneeland's spirit with him every step of the way.
